Output 423d22839a4d81f3f07a4f6a03b96c3887fe64409903c1bbd3705f6b988f2642:0

value
2573262918
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b8d9b4ff11392ea502b5384d55deeb39d28cb67d OP_EQUAL
address
MQkZNGwkjcTXzaTSJHtDUDiDJx2QSdxQhc
transaction
423d22839a4d81f3f07a4f6a03b96c3887fe64409903c1bbd3705f6b988f2642
spent
true